Who We Are

Stensul dramatically reduces marketing content creation time - by up to 90% - so teams can better focus on improving marketing performance. Stensul makes this possible by streamlining the collaboration process and simplifying marketing asset creation for all marketers so they can create high-performing campaigns that drive stronger results. Stensul integrates with all leading ESPs/MAPs, workflow platforms, image digital asset management platforms, live content, link tracking, and messaging platforms. Top brands that trust Stensul to solve their most demanding marketing creation problems include BlackRock, Cisco, Demandbase, Equifax, Greenhouse, Siemens, Thomson Reuters, and Yahoo.

Position Overview

We’re looking for a Events & Account-Based Marketing Manager who brings both creative flair and operational rigor to every event touchpoint. You’ll lead the strategy and flawless execution of owned and sponsored events—from industry dinners and VIP customer activations to high-impact trade shows and integrated field programs. You will also work closely with the Director of Revenue Marketing to execute bespoke campaigns for highest priority accounts - both prospects and customers. 

This role is pivotal to our Account-Based AllBound Strategy and supports our mission to deliver standout experiences for key personas at top-tier accounts. You’ll work cross-functionally with sales, solutions, product marketing, and customer success to deliver events that engage, convert, and expand.

What You’ll Do
  • Own the event marketing strategy across the funnel: field events, customer roundtables, trade shows, and virtual event activations
  • Plan and execute 1:few and 1:many account-based events, with tight alignment to ICP tiers and sales motions
  • Partner with sales to build pre-event outreach and post-event follow-up workflows that drive meetings and pipeline
  • Lead event operations: contracts, vendors, budget, logistics, swag, gifting, and measurement
  • Drive executive engagement with high-value VIP experiences, including executive dinners, roadshows, and roundtables
  • Collaborate with content, brand, and design to bring Stensul’s narrative to life through immersive experiences
  • Create post-event reporting to measure impact across pipeline velocity, opportunity progression, and influenced revenue
  • Manage and optimize the use of event tools

What You’ll Need
  • 5+ years of B2B event marketing experience with a proven track record of driving pipeline and influence across enterprise deals
  • Experience building event programs as part of an ABM or AllBound strategy
  • Strategic mindset paired with operational excellence—can own both the “why” and the “how"
  • Strong cross-functional collaborator who thrives in fast-paced, high-output environments
  • Excellent project manager—detail-obsessed and deadline-driven
  • Experience with CRM, MAP, and campaign reporting tools (e.g., Salesforce, Marketo), preferred
  • Willingness to travel 10–20% for event execution

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ene

As the undisputed financial capital of the world, New York City is an epicenter of startup funding activity. The city has a thriving fintech scene and is a major player in verticals ranging from AI to biotech, cybersecurity and digital media. It also has universities like NYU, Columbia and Cornell Tech attracting students and researchers from across the globe, providing the ecosystem with a constant influx of world-class talent. And its East Coast location and three international airports make it a perfect spot for European companies establishing a foothold in the United States.

Key Facts About NYC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
  •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
